2010-07-06 5 views

답변

6

먼저 원격 컴퓨터에서 원격 컴퓨터를 사용하도록 설정해야합니다. 실행하는 컴퓨터에 프롬프트 상승 (관리자)에서 로그 :

Enable-PSRemoting -Force 

그런 다음 원격 컴퓨터에서 명령을 실행하기 위해 호출-명령을 사용할 수 있습니다. 스크립트의 경우, 당신은 아마 원격 컴퓨터에 새 PSSession을 (뉴-하여 PSSession)을 만든 다음 호출-명령에 대한 예를 들어 매개 변수로 해당 세션을 사용하여 명령을 호출 할 :

$s = new-PSSession -computername (import-csv servers.csv) ` 
        -credential domain01\admin01 -throttlelimit 16 
invoke-command -session $s -scriptblock {get-process powershell} -AsJob 

주 당신 원격 관리 인프라를 사용할 수 있도록 관리자 (관리자) 프롬프트에서 실행해야합니다. about_remote 항목 (man about_remote)뿐만 아니라 자세한 내용은이 두 cmdlet에 대한 도움말을 참조하십시오.

+0

고마워요! 다른 모든 기능을 작동 시키면 로컬 컴퓨터를 원격 컴퓨터로 활성화하여 (원격 메서드가 작동하는지 테스트) 가능합니까? – John

관련 문제